It's easier to do fancy-looking sites with Flash - but that's not necessarily better.
It's easier to do functional websites with HTML, Search Engines like it better too.
The key question is what you want your visitors to do with your website.
At PhotoDeck (, we do only HTML sites - but they're e-commerce photography sites geared towards image sales and delivery rather than portfolios. We have a partnership with A Photo Folio, as Jon mentioned they do flash for the time being, but they're clean designs and similar things could be done in HTML too.
In fact, one of our users is now planning to create another PhotoDeck website for his portfolio, it won't be fancy but there is something to be said for simplicity and performance...